See that's the thing though, Cruel Ultimatum is the win con (it seems like it anyways). You control your opponents board until you can cast a cruel ultimatum that sets you so far ahead of your opponent that you just win the game from there; the card is so much card advantage that your opponent won't be able to catch up. They also have man lands, which are also a win con but I would add another Creeping Tar Pit personally.

So i'm pretty new to the Vault. Also, I guess I feel new to Magic in general even though I played back in the day; the meta game is very alien to me. I just gotta ask, is the super high cost of the deck necessary for some reason or is it just a clever meta joke? Scalding Tarn, for example, seems completely ridiculous to add to the deck, since it's basically just an Evolving Wilds that costs a ton of money and makes you lose life. So....meta joke, or necessarily $700??

0
Posted 05 September 2014 at 14:40

Permalink

The difference is really that you can search for Ravinca Shock lands, or Original Dual Lands (Volcanic Island, Tropical Island, ect.), which is insanely powerful, allowing you to fix your mana by finding dual lands with it, thinning your deck (though some don't buy this benefit), and allowing them to come in untapped is super powerful. Though this isn't necessarily powerful to casual players, but it is powerful to a lot of competitive level modern, legacy and vintage players (possibly standard once khans of tarkir comes out).

0
Posted 05 September 2014 at 14:56

Permalink

Basically you are paying for consistency in your deck, and when you are in three colors you need to be able to cast all of your spells consistently.
